#65b980 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#65b980 is composed of 39.6% red, 72.5% green and 50.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 45.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 30.8% yellow and 27.5% black. It has a hue angle of 139.3 degrees, a saturation of 37.5% and a lightness of 56.1%. #65b980 color hex could be obtained by blending #caffff with #007301. Closest websafe color is: #66cc99.

Shades and Tints of #65b980

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040805 is the darkest color, while #f9fcf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#65b980

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#87978c is the less saturated color, while #20fe67 is the most saturated one.
